I've got a Black Box that I'm playing into a large heavy SS amp. I love it--sounds GREAT.
I have several smaller tube amps, an old Princeton, a 40watt Pignose, and a Fender Hot Rod Deluxe. Is the Sarno Black Box just somewhat redundant with those amps, or would it add benefits? Are their any negatives? I played with it some with the smaller tube amps, and can't really tell as of yet, and electronics is a challenge to me--want to make sure there's no down side.

If you are using effects devices, running the Black Box before the devices is a good idea. But if you are just going straight into a tube amp you probably don't need the BB. It shouldn't hurt anything to try using it. Do what sounds best to you.

I would definitely use the Black Box in that setup. It's not just about having tubes involved in the rig, but there's a LOT to having a tube as the very first thing the pickup sees, before those pedals. Definitely should use the BB there!
